Tales from the Museum Basement with Garston Phillips

Date: 07th February 2017 Time: 13:00 - 14:00 Location: City Art Gallery and Museum Cost: £2 - booking essential Book for a guided tour of the geology, natural history and fine art collections in the underground stores of Worcester City Museum on Foregate Street, Worcester. Join Worcester Museum's longest standing curator to hear the story of our museum collections and see some of the weirdest and most curious objects and specimens that are still looked after in the basement of our Foregate Street Museum. From pickled piglets and mummified cats to our hundred year old beef sandwich. This talk promises to be entertaining and surprising. £2 per person.
